Catarina Santos nº4 9ºC

The man behind the legend Martin was born in the year 316, was the son of a Roman officer in Pannonia (now Hungary). On November 8, in Candes and was buried three days later in Tours.

According to legend … It was the year 338, one day in winter cold and rainy, Martin walked the lands of Amiens, in France where a poor, almost naked, asking for a handout to Martin. As I can not bring anything to give, Martin ripping his cloak in half, giving half to the beggar. According to the legend immediately opens the sky, the rain and the sun shines.

In Portugal... S. Martin is the saint of winter that signals the end of the cultures and the beginning of the feast of wine and chestnuts. It is the patron of, among others, tailors, knights, beggars and wine producers. There are 60 cities with the name of St. Martin. Much of them in homage to the saint of Tours.

Chestnut The nut is a fruit that comes from a tree, the chestnut. A group called chestnut chestnut. The chestnut tree is protected by a ball full of peaks called "hedgehog". When autumn arrives, the hedgehog opens and drops the nut on the ground. Before the potato arrived in Europe and spread everywhere (XVII), the nut was a staple food, especially in the field.
